DIRECTOR OF PRODUCT DEVELOPMENT

Job Summary :

This person will manage a team of 3-4 people. They will collaborate closely with cross-functional teams, including designers, suppliers, manufacturers, and sales, to ensure the successful conception, development, and launch of high-quality products that resonate with customers' needs and preferences.

Responsibilities for this role :

Develop and maintain daily email summaries per project, recording and communicating all program details to the agents / factories such as : timing and action, consumer testing, sample requests, product information including color specifications, size, fabric details etc.

This is also the repository of all change requests to the factory.

  • Maintain approximately 20 summaries / projects daily depending on season.
  • Evaluate all incoming samples for design, color, sizing, and quality etc.
  • Organize and clearly label all samples in development.
  • Arrange and expedite product samples for upcoming sales meetings.
  • Work closely with the art department to facilitate uploading artwork to the factory for development.
  • Provide links to location of artwork and spec sheets to the art department and overseas team.
  • Review artwork for color limitations etc. prior to sending. Send prototypes and / or color standards to the factory as necessary.
  • Work closely with the packaging department to ensure all packaging is correct.
  • Work closely with Quality Control Manager ensuring product is tested at the correct retailer designated lab, following correct protocols.
  • Work closely with the production department ensuring ship dates reflected in daily communications with the factory are correct.
  • Review purchase orders and production forms for accuracy.
  • Assist with sample reviews, organizing and tasks as requested.
  • Manage and take responsibility for all deadlines, licensor approvals, retailer requirements per project.
  • Troubleshoot and call out potential problems and offer solutions.
  • Communicate with overseas teams.

Qualifications and Skills :

  • Bachelor's degree in Textile Design, Product Development, Merchandising, or a related field.
  • Proven experience in product development, preferably within the home textiles industry.
  • Must have proven experience managing others well.
  • Strong understanding of textile materials, production processes, and quality control standards.
  • Excellent project management skills with the ability to multitask and manage competing priorities.
  • Effective commun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Attention to detail and a keen eye for design aesthetics.
  • Proficiency in using relevant software tools such as Microsoft Office, project management software.
  • Knowledge of sustainability practices and trends in the textiles industry is a plus.

Must be willing to work in the office 4 days / week minimum.
